"One aspect of my research was speaking with parents who were searching for a diagnosis for their child. I was trying to understand more about the hoops they had to jump through as they did not have a name for their child’s condition. Some of the findings from this work were used in an application to the National Lottery to set up a support group for parents in this situation (SWAN UK). It was lovely to have something tangible and positive come out of academic research."
